1[an error occurred while processing this directive] | 1Then Bildad the Shuhite replied: |
2[an error occurred while processing this directive] | 2"How long will you say such things? Your words are a blustering wind. |
3[an error occurred while processing this directive] | 3Does God pervert justice? Does the Almighty pervert what is right? |
4[an error occurred while processing this directive] | 4When your children sinned against him, he gave them over to the penalty of their sin. |
5[an error occurred while processing this directive] | 5But if you will seek God earnestly and plead with the Almighty, |
6[an error occurred while processing this directive] | 6if you are pure and upright, even now he will rouse himself on your behalf and restore you to your prosperous state. |
7[an error occurred while processing this directive] | 7Your beginnings will seem humble, so prosperous will your future be. |
8[an error occurred while processing this directive] | 8"Ask the former generation and find out what their ancestors learned, |
9[an error occurred while processing this directive] | 9for we were born only yesterday and know nothing, and our days on earth are but a shadow. |
10[an error occurred while processing this directive] | 10Will they not instruct you and tell you? Will they not bring forth words from their understanding? |
11[an error occurred while processing this directive] | 11Can papyrus grow tall where there is no marsh? Can reeds thrive without water? |
12[an error occurred while processing this directive] | 12While still growing and uncut, they wither more quickly than grass. |
13[an error occurred while processing this directive] | 13Such is the destiny of all who forget God; so perishes the hope of the godless. |
14[an error occurred while processing this directive] | 14What they trust in is fragile; what they rely on is a spider's web. |
15[an error occurred while processing this directive] | 15They lean on the web, but it gives way; they cling to it, but it does not hold. |
16[an error occurred while processing this directive] | 16They are like a well-watered plant in the sunshine, spreading its shoots over the garden; |
17[an error occurred while processing this directive] | 17it entwines its roots around a pile of rocks and looks for a place among the stones. |
18[an error occurred while processing this directive] | 18But when it is torn from its spot, that place disowns it and says, 'I never saw you.' |
19[an error occurred while processing this directive] | 19Surely its life withers away, and from the soil other plants grow. |
20[an error occurred while processing this directive] | 20"Surely God does not reject one who is blameless or strengthen the hands of evildoers. |
21[an error occurred while processing this directive] | 21He will yet fill your mouth with laughter and your lips with shouts of joy. |
22[an error occurred while processing this directive] | 22Your enemies will be clothed in shame, and the tents of the wicked will be no more." |
